Embodiment 1

[0040] A dairy cow teat protector, consisting of the following ingredients:

[0041] 15 parts of myricetin modified chitosan microspheres, 10 parts of purslane extract, 6 parts of coix seed oil, 8 parts of hydrolyzed gelatin and 50 parts of fish oil.

[0042] The preparation method of described myricetin modified chitosan microspheres is:

[0043] S1. Weigh chitosan, add it to acetic acid aqueous solution, stir until completely dissolved, then add myricetin, continue stirring until completely dissolved, and obtain a dispersed water phase; weigh emulsifier and add it to petroleum ether, stir and disperse until uniform After that, a continuous oil phase is obtained;

[0044] Wherein, the mass ratio of chitosan, myricetin and acetic acid aqueous solution is 1:0.2:45, and the mass fraction of acetic acid aqueous solution is 2%; The mass ratio of emulsifier and sherwood oil is 1:8;

Abstract

The invention discloses a dairy cow nipple protective agent, which is prepared from the following ingredients in parts by weight: 5 to 20 parts of myricetin modified chitosan microspheres, 5 to 15 parts of herba portulacae extracts, 2 to 8 parts of coix seed oil, 5 to 10 parts of hydrolyzed gelatin and 40 to 60 parts of fish oil. Most of the components of the protective agent prepared by the invention are natural and non-toxic substances, so that the protective agent has small irritation to breast and nipple skin of dairy cows; the protective agent has a good moisturizing effect, good dispersion and absorption effect and good antibacterial and anti-inflammatory effect, and does not have the defects of drug resistance and safety like iodine-based disinfectants, so that the protective agent is suitable for being used for a long time.

technical field [0001] The invention relates to the field of milk cow teat protectant, in particular to a milk cow teat protectant and a preparation method thereof. Background technique [0002] Modern dairy farms use milking parlors for centralized milking. Mechanical milking uses negative pressure milking, which requires relatively high operating requirements. In practice, due to time and technical constraints, cows are often not properly milked during the milking process. Factors such as milking, or milking cups that are not cleaned can induce mastitis or cause teat damage, resulting in reduced production of cows and potential mastitis hazards. At present, the commonly used solution is to clean the udder and teats before milking. The cleaning solution contains disinfectants to ensure that there are no pathogenic bacteria in the milk area during milking. , with film-forming agent, to effectively protect the nipple.
